DOH-Brevard Offers Incentives For First-Time COVID-19 Vaccinations
BREVARD COUNTY, FL. – Florida Department of Health-Brevard is working to incentivize residents to get their COVID-19 shots, offering food vouchers for local grocery stores, free zoo admission and even a free breakfast.
DOH-Brevard is offering $10 food vouchers for those who get their first COVID-19 vaccination at Health Department Clinics in Viera, Titusville and Melbourne. Food vouchers are also available at all outreach events while supplies last. Beginning this past Thursday, parents receive a food voucher when their 12-plus year-old received their first COVID-19 vaccination. Food vouchers are good at large area grocery chains like Publix, Winn-Dixie, Albertsons, Food Lion and Save A Lot and are available while supplies last. DOH-Brevard Clinic locations:
• Melbourne, 601 E. University Blvd, 32901
• Viera, 2565 Judge Fran Jamieson Way, 32940
• Titusville, 611 North Singleton Ave., 32796
